The Role of Maternal-Fetal Cholesterol Transport in Early Fetal Life: Current Insights1
15 Nov 2012
Abstract excerpt
The importance of maternal cholesterol as an exogenous cholesterol source for the growing embryo was first reported in studies of Smith-Lemli-Opitz syndrome. Although most of the fetus's cholesterol is synthesized by the fetus itself, there is now growing evidence that during the first weeks of life, when most organs develop, the fetus largely depends on maternal cholesterol as its cholesterol source.
